What Does Samadhi Mean? Sadhguru Breaks Down The Ancient Yogic Concept
In a recent YouTube talk, Sadhguru explored the yogic concept of Samadhi and explained how it differs from conventional meditation. He described Samadhi as a state of equanimity where the intellect no longer constantly judges experiences as good or bad. According to Sadhguru, it is not merely a relaxation technique but a deeper state of awareness cultivated through sustained spiritual practice, balance, and a transformed way of perceiving life.

Sameera Reddy Gets Candid About Her Struggle With Skin Colour & Body Image Insecurities for Over 20 Years
Sameera Reddy has opened up about the appearance pressures she faced during her early years in Bollywood, revealing that she was made "two to three shades lighter" for her debut film, 'Maine Dil Tujhko Diya'. She also recalled wearing full-body makeup, padded bras, bum pads and coloured lenses to fit industry beauty standards. Sameera candidly spoke about body-shaming, colour bias, and her long journey toward self-acceptance.

Is India Discouraging Gold Buying? CA Sakchi Jain Shares Key Insights
India's gold landscape may be undergoing a silent transformation, as highlighted by CA Sakchi Jain. With rising import duties, policy signals, and the launch of digital gold options, the focus seems to be shifting from physical gold to financial alternatives. While gold remains a cultural favourite, these coordinated steps suggest a broader push to reduce imports, stabilise the economy, and encourage smarter, more productive investment habits among Indian households.

Anaya Bangar Undergoes Gender Change Surgery; Thanks Father For Supporting Her
Anaya Bangar, daughter of former Indian cricketer Sanjay Bangar, has shared that she successfully underwent gender-affirming surgery in Thailand, marking a major milestone in her transition. In an emotional post, she thanked her father for eventually embracing and supporting her journey. Assigned male at birth and formerly known as Aryan, Anaya previously played agegroup cricket and began HRT in 2023. She continues to speak openly about her challenges and growth.
